Guest guest Posted January 20, 2003 Report Share Posted January 20, 2003 I make this in a bread maker with a special gluten-free cycle, so I don't know how well it would work in other machines or by hand. But the taste is wonderful and makes an awesome salad sandwich. It makes a very large loaf. MULTI-GRAIN BREAD 3 cups water (may vary) 1/2 cup oil 1 teaspoon vinegar 1/2 cup brown rice flour 1/2 cup besan (chick pea, garbanzo) 2 cups white rice flour 1 cup arrowroot 4 teaspoons xanthan or guar gum 4 tablespoons sugar 1 1/2 teaspoons salt 2 teaspoons baking powder 6 teaspoons egg replacer 1/2 cup soy milk powder 4 teaspoons poppy seeds 4 teaspoons sesame seeds 4 teaspoons linseeds 6 teaspoons sunflower seeds 3 teaspoons yeast granules Make as per instructions for bread maker, or mix as you normally would by hand.
